How to Terminate a 25 Pair 1A Distribution Connector - The TSOC™ Minute (ep. 17)
How to Terminate a 25 Pair 1A Distribution Connector Materials Required: TMBX-1A: 25 Pair 1A Distribution Connector (5 Pair Markings) PTBX-16A-BL: Impact Termination Tool Needle Nose Pliers MST-502: Cable Prep Tool TMBX-4POSN: 100 Pair Distribution Frame TF-4IV: 4" Nylon Cable Ties TMBX-DSWH-EA: Designation Strip (White) TMBX-DLBL-EA: Designation Label (Blue) FT4-25PC3GY: 25 Pair CAT 3 UTP Solid Cable (Grey) Step 1: Cut the specified length of 25 Pair CAT 3 UTP Solid Cable (FT4-25PC3GY) and score the jacket using the Cable Prep Tool (MST-502). Squeeze handles of the Cable Prep Tool gently and turn in both directions. Step 2: The 25 Pair Cable will be scored. Remove the jacket exposing the 50 insulated conductors and the nylon thread pull string. Use the Needle Nose Pliers to pull the string stripping the jacket the required length and trim the Cable where scored. Step 3: Place Nylon Cable Ties into the designated slots of the 25 Pair Distribution Connector (TMBX-1A). Place the exposed 25 Pair Cable along the top of the BIX Connector with the 5 pair markings starting from the left side and secure the Cable Ties. Step 4: Install the Distribution Connector into the required position of the 100 Pair Distribution Frame (TMBX-4POSN). Separate each pair of the 25 Pair Cable and lace into the Distribution Connector according to the required wiring code. Use the Impact Termination Tool (PTBX-16A-BL) to punch down and cut one insulated conductor at a time. Step 5: Remove the Distribution Connector to inspect that all insulated conductors are terminated to the (IDC) Insulated Displacement Connectors. Insert the Distribution Connector into the Distribution Frame with the terminated Cable side down. Step 6: Place the required Designation Label (TMBX-DLBL-EA) onto the Designation Strip (TMBX-DSWH-EA) and install into the appropriate position of the Distribution Frame.
